Apartments for Rent in Seminole Grove, Seminole, FL

Adjacent to downtown Seminole, Seminole Grove Estates has a central location with quick access to the rest of the city. The neighborhood is about a block southwest of St. Petersburg College-Seminole Campus and roughly eight miles south of Clearwater. West Coast beaches are easily accessible for swimming, boating, fishing, and beachcombing. Gulf Boulevard, a beachfront roadway with several beach access locations, is about three miles from Seminole Grove Estates. Locals do their shopping and hang out at the Seminole City Center, a shopping center with different sections for retail and entertainment.

Seminole Grove Estates has several side streets with single-story houses and apartments surrounded by trees and other greenery so you can find a peaceful, quiet place to call home. Seminole Boulevard, to the east of the neighborhood, features a variety of restaurants, including Two Cousins Pizzeria, where you can grab a New York-style pizza pie. While this area has large grocery chains, locals enjoy visiting Capo De Monte Italian Market, a hidden gem nestled between a couple of large buildings, for authentic Italian food.


Seminole Grove - Seminole, FL Rental Insights

Average Rent Rates

What is the average rent in Seminole Grove - Seminole, FL?

The average rent for the Seminole Grove neighborhood of Seminole, FL is $1,445, but rentals range from as little as $456 to as much as $2,124 depending on the rental style.

What is the average rent of a Studio apartment in Seminole Grove - Seminole, FL?

Looking for a studio apartment in the Seminole Grove neighborhood? Expect to pay around $456 per month.

What is the average rent of a 1 bedroom apartment in Seminole Grove - Seminole, FL?

One bedroom Seminole Grove apartments rent for around $1,445 per month.

What is the average rent of a 2 bedroom apartment in Seminole Grove - Seminole, FL?

Seminole Grove has two bedroom apartments that rent for around $1,672 per month.

What is the average rent of a 3 bedroom apartment in Seminole Grove - Seminole, FL?

Three bedroom apartments in Seminole Grove are usually priced around $2,124 per month.
